Output 1691e22c18229ab288edf1a04892789efd72ee45fca57b9cc26b74351281245e:0

value
491052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e55bc3a5349aece587696ff1de5dc1377568926a OP_EQUALVERIFY OP_CHECKSIG
address
1MujfpaXCxAqMF9VGqEDyfPfs1uG6qt9qL
transaction
1691e22c18229ab288edf1a04892789efd72ee45fca57b9cc26b74351281245e
spent
true